At its heart, a crash game operates on a provably fair system, meaning the outcome of each round is determined by a cryptographic algorithm that can be independently verified by players. This transparency is crucial for building trust and ensuring a fair gaming experience. The random number generator (RNG) controls when the “crash” will occur, and this is typically determined before the start of each round. While the exact timing of the crash is unpredictable, the algorithm ensures fairness and prevents manipulation. Players need understand that while these games are demonstrably fair, they still involve inherent risk.
The multiplier isn't simply increasing linearly; it often follows a curve, starting with a slow, steady climb and then accelerating rapidly as the potential crash point approaches. This curve is designed to add to the tension and encourage players to cash out before the multiplier reaches its peak. Different platforms may use slightly different curves, impacting the overall gameplay experience. Understanding these nuances can influence a player’s tactical decisions. The inherent volatility means that returns are highly variable; you may win big, but can equally experience consecutive losses.
A key element to playing crash games successfully is developing a robust risk management strategy. This doesn’t guarantee wins, but it can significantly reduce potential losses. One popular approach is implementing a fixed percentage cash-out strategy. This involves setting a specific multiplier at which you will automatically cash out, regardless of the current multiplier value. Another common technique is the Martingale system, where you double your bet after each loss, aiming to recover previous losses with a single win. However, this system can quickly deplete your bankroll if you encounter a prolonged losing streak. Diversification of bet sizes is also a debated strategy, with some favouring larger initial bets and others preferring smaller, more frequent wagers.
It’s vital to set a budget and stick to it. The excitement of the game can lead to impulsive betting, so predetermining a loss limit is crucial. Furthermore, be mindful of the “gambler’s fallacy” – the mistaken belief that past outcomes influence future events. Each round is independent, and previous crashes or wins do not affect the outcome of subsequent rounds. Disciplined play, combined with a solid understanding of the game's mechanics, provides the best chance for prolonged enjoyment and potential profitability.

The addictive nature of crash games is, in part, attributable to the psychological principles they exploit. The intermittent reinforcement schedule – where rewards are delivered unpredictably – is a powerful driver of compulsive behavior. Similar mechanisms are found in slot machines and other forms of gambling. Every round offers the possibility of a big win, creating a sense of hope and anticipation that keeps players engaged. The near-miss effect – when the multiplier almost reaches your cash-out point before crashing – can be particularly potent, reinforcing the desire to play one more round. The quick pace of the game and the instant feedback further contribute to its addictive potential.
The social aspect, often facilitated by live chat features, can also play a significant role. Players share their wins and losses, creating a sense of community and camaraderie. This can lead to individuals continuing to play based on the perceived successes of others, rather than their own rational assessment of risk. The environment can contribute towards irrational decision making, where emotion overrides logic. It's crucial to remain objective and avoid being swayed by the experiences of others.
It is crucial to be aware of the signs of problem gambling and to seek help if needed. These signs include spending more time and money on gambling than you can afford, chasing losses, lying to family and friends about your gambling habits, and experiencing feelings of guilt or shame. If you find yourself exhibiting these behaviors, it is important to reach out to a support organization or professional counselor. Many resources are available to help individuals overcome gambling addiction and regain control of their lives. These resources are confidential and can provide valuable support and guidance.

The regulatory status of crash games varies significantly across different jurisdictions. Some countries have explicitly legalized and regulated these games, while others remain in a gray area, and some have outright banned them. The lack of consistent regulation presents challenges for both operators and players. Operators must navigate a complex web of licensing requirements and compliance obligations, while players need to ensure they are playing on licensed and reputable platforms. This is especially important when dealing with cryptocurrency transactions.
The focus of regulators is often on ensuring fairness, preventing money laundering, and protecting vulnerable individuals from problem gambling. Many jurisdictions are adopting a precautionary approach, scrutinizing the games closely to assess their potential risks. The move towards stricter regulations is likely to continue, driven by concerns about consumer protection and the integrity of the online gambling industry. Increased transparency and collaboration between operators and regulators are crucial for fostering a safe and sustainable environment.
